The Best Things You Can Do When You No Longer Feel The Love In Your Marriage

What can you do when it comes to saving a marriage after the love is gone and the relationship turns sour? Well, first you must understand that every relationship has a cycle and your marriage is no different.

When your relationship began you and your spouse fell in love and you wanted their touch, time, and attention. At this stage of the relationship the love and passion is very high. Falling in love with your partner was easy because you didn't have to do anything.

It was very passive and spontaneous when you and your spouse fell in love. Sadly, as the years go by the love you both previously shared begins to fade away.

There is nothing wrong with your relationship because this is a natural part of the cycle. All the touching, time, and attention you once wanted from your spouse is no longer a necessity.

At this point in your marriage you notice the huge difference between the start when you both were crazy in love and the much worse stages that follows. This is where the marriage starts to breakdown and you may begin blaming your partner for your depression and you look outside your marriage for fulfillment.

Of course you can fall in love once again with another person but the good feelings you have will just be temporary. This is due to the fact that further down the road you will be dealing with the exact same situation again.

This is why it's important to do everything you can for saving a marriage after the love is gone and not jump ship. In order to save marriage after the love is gone you must learn how to sustain the love you have already found.

It is impossible to find a love that will last forever so you must make it last and get better each day. Sustaining the love you have for your partner is not passive and it will take time, effort, and energy.

Some of the things involved in sustaining the love in your marriage involve: keeping yourself in shape, complimenting your spouse, being unexpected and find ways to surprise your spouse, and of course communicating with your spouse intimately on a daily basis.

Learning how to save a marriage after the love is gone and the relationship turns sour takes time. If you focus more time on learning to love the person you found you will be better off.
